H1B Visa Sponsorship Overview

Chevron Corporation, based in San Ramon, TX, has filed 1,353 H1B labor condition applications with the U.S. Department of Labor since FY2008. According to USCIS data, the company has an overall 98.9% petition approval rate, with 174 approvals and 2 denials for initial employment petitions.

The average salary offered on H1B applications is $126,053. This is -35.0% compared to the national median salary of $197,570 for the most common position, Petroleum Engineers.

Chevron Corporation has also filed 172 green card (PERM) applications, with 74 certified, indicating long-term sponsorship commitment for foreign workers. Green Card Sponsor

Chevron Corporation operates in the Mining, Quarrying, and Oil and Gas Extraction industry.
